15 Stunning Washington Coast Cabins You’ll Never Want to Leave

woman on the porch of one of the Washington coast cabins you should visit

I’m always on the lookout for Washington coast cabins because I head to the area every summer with my family. I love how the Washington coast has it all: you can relax on the beach and do absolutely nothing or fill your day with outdoor activities (like visiting one of the best national parks in the Pacific Northwest).

Choosing a home base that provides enough to do on the property while also being close to area attractions is important to me, so I keep a running list of places to stay that fit the bill. Rather than keep it to myself, I thought I’d share some of the best Washington coast cabins I have saved for future visits.

Whether you’re traveling as a couple, family, or pet parent, here are my favorite cabins on the Washington coast that are perfect for your next trip.

Boardwalk Cottages

link to book | Long beach, WA | bedrooms: 1-3 | baths: 1-2 | fits 2-8 people | cost: starts at ~$325/night | pet friendly | pool

living room in one of the WA coast cabins you should visit

The Boardwalk Cottages are part of the Adrift Hotel property in the popular Long Beach area on the southern Washington Coast. It’s perfect for people who want a bit more seclusion than the hotel offers but still desire hotel amenities like a pool and spa.

Choose from studio cottages perfect for couples or mult-bedroom beach houses for groups. All cabin rentals come with WiFi, flat screen TVs, memory foam mattresses, and local coffee and tea. You also have access to cruiser bikes, EV charging stations, and an Instagrammable barrel sauna.

Adorable Beach Cottage

link to book | Copalis Beach,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 1 | fits 5 people | cost: ~$220/night

inside one of the best Washington coast cabins with a wood burning stove

This quaint seaside cottage has vaulted ceilings, white paint, and a ton of windows, making for a bright and airy space. The main living room is anchored by a retro wood-burning stove, and there’s an open concept kitchen perfect for gathering.

Or take it outside and enjoy the seats around the fire pit. It’s the perfect way to relax after a day spent on the beach about 1/2 mile away, accessed by your own private path.

Codfish Cottage Cabin

link to book | Clallam County, WA | bedrooms: 1 | baths: 1 | fits 4 people | cost: ~$245/night | pet friendly

cozy bedroom in a seaside cabin on the Washington coast

I can’t stop thinking about this tiny seaside shack right on the water near Port Angeles and all the fun things to do in Poulsbo. It has a gorgeous deck with Adirondack chairs for taking in the views. Or you can enjoy the scenery from bed thanks to the picture windows. If you’re visiting during winter, you may even see the large, haunting king tides!

Note that there’s no electricity. But don’t fret, there’s still a fridge, stove, and lights powered by propane. There’s also a fully operational bathroom. The listing says there’s internet too, but I’d inquire about that to confirm.

Oceanfront Beach Home

link to book | Westport, WA | bedrooms: 3 | baths: 3 | fits 6 people | cost: ~$500/night | dog friendly | hot tub

Washington coast cabin with a hot tub and deck

This waterfront stunner is perfect for families looking to stay right on the beach. It has plenty of bedrooms, a gourmet kitchen, updated bathrooms, and a large deck. Enjoy the views of the ocean and dunes from the patio furniture, fire pit, or hot tub as you get dinner ready on the grill.

There’s also access to the 3-mile-long paved Westport Oceanfront Trail that leads from the lighthouse along the ocean’s edge to the marina. Don’t forget your bikes or rollerblades!

Cozy Seashell Cottage

link to book | Port Angeles,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 1 | fits 4 people | cost: ~$200/night

living room of a shabby chic cabin in Washington

You may not want to leave this shabby chic cottage right in the heart of Port Angeles. It has thoughtful decor throughout, including chandeliers, floral decor, and a stunning clawfoot tub.

If you do decide to leave, though, you’re close to all the best Washington coast attractions, including the Olympic National Park.

Crazy Nice Cabin

link to book | Long Beach,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 4 | fits 6 people | cost: ~$425/night | dog friendly | hot tub

yard of a two-story Washington coast cabin

I can’t get over the grounds of this Washington coast vacation rental. It has corn hole, a covered hot tub, fire pit, ladder golf, and path to the beach. The indoor amenities are equally impressive with my beloved ping pong, foosball, tons of TVs, all the video game consoles you can think of, Sonos…the list just keeps going. If you’re all about those creature comforts, you will love this Washington coast cabin!

Pro tip: Long Beach is the perfect area for those wanting to make a day trip to the Oregon Coast and exploring all the things to do near Cannon Beach.

Stunning Beachy Cottage

link to book | Moclips, WA | bedrooms: 1 | baths: 1 | fits 4 people | cost: ~$100/night

inside a bright Washington coast cabin

This is one of the best Washington coast cabins for those who like high style. The walls are a blank canvas with bright white shiplap, which they stylize with bold navy decor. You’ll also find high-end design elements like a clawfoot tub and retro chiminea fire pit.

Outside you get Pacific Ocean views that you can take in from the expansive yard and outdoor deck. Or head about 3/4 mile down the road to the beach with the provided beach chairs in tow.

Pro tip: This cabin is near all the fun things to do in Seabrook, WA, the seaside community I go to every year with my family (which also has house rentals).

Beachcomber Cottage

link to book | Port Angeles,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 1 | fits 6 people | cost: ~$375/night

inside a Washington coast cabin with crabs and sails on the walls

This quirky cottage has fun seaside decor like buoys and sails lining the wall. It’s on a large property called Whiskey Beach with other vacation rentals, RV hookups, and tents. But you’ll have a large yard with a private fire pit and picnic table to yourself. It’s the perfect respite after exploring the nearby shores and all the unique things to do in Victoria BC just across the water.

Oceanfront Vacation Home

link to book | Oceanside,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 2 | fits 8 people | cost: ~$530/night | hot tub

lofted cabin with wood work

The woodwork in this property is some of the most beautiful among all of these Washington coast cabins. Enjoy it from the two-story loft as you take in the seagrass waving to you from outside. Or kick back on the large deck with a hot tub before heading out to the beach from you own beach access path.

Boutique Cabin

link to book | Oceanside,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 2 | fits 4 people | cost: ~$500/night | dog friendly | hot tub

Great room inside a cabin on the Washington coast with a floor-to-ceiling fireplace

This property is handmade by a small vacation rental company based on the Washington coast. It has a stunning great room with a stone fireplace that goes all the up to the second ceiling. There’s a gourmet kitchen, big screen TV, tons of plants, and plenty of nooks for relaxation.

The relaxation continues outside with a hot tub, outdoor soaker bathtub, corn hole, and a path to the beach.

Lake Dream Chalet

link to book | Maple Grove,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 2 | fits 4 people | cost: ~$600/night | hot tub

dock overlooking a misty lake

Enjoy epic views of the lake from this a-frame cabin nestled in the woods on the north part of the Olympic Peninsula. It has a wonderful dock, hammock, and canoe. So you can take in all the activities the shore has to offer. When you’re ready to head back to the house, continue enjoying the views from the hot tub on your own private deck.

Tide Pool Cabin

link to book | Ocean Shores, WA | bedrooms: 2 | baths: 2 | fits 8 people | cost: ~$230/night | pet friendly

hotel room on the WA coast

This is probably the most funky of the Washington coast cabins on this list. It’s part of a hotel and has a healthy dose of tiles, textures, polka dots, and woods throughout the space. It makes for an inspiring and eclectic interior perfect for coming back to after a day on the beach.

Outside you’ll find wicker cocoon chairs, fire pit, and plenty of space for spreading out.

Stella Mare Cabin

link to book | Pacific Beach, WA | bedrooms: 3 | baths: 2 | fits 10 people | cost: ~$250/night | pet friendly

inside a beachy seaside cabin

This Washington coast cabin has an inviting front porch that just beckons you to come inside. Once you do, you’ll be met with colorful, beachy interiors that feel really on theme considering the ocean is just 1.5 blocks away. Cozy up in one of the nooks throughout the house. Or get some excitement playing horseshoes or bocce ball in the expansive yard.

The Hideaway

link to book | Port Angeles, WA | bedrooms: 3 | baths: 2 | fits 6 people | cost: ~$500/night | dog friendly | hot tub

kitchen and living room in a modern cabin in WA

This cottage is secluded and surrounded by trees. But with openings so you can see the pretty water views from the deck and private hot tub. Inside you’ll be met with modern black and white decor, but you may not want to spend too much time indoors thanks to the prime proximity to the beach and paved Olympic Discovery Trail.

Weather Beach Cabin

link to book | Ocean Park, WA | bedrooms: 3 | baths: 3 | fits 8 people | cost: ~$360/night | dog friendly

living and dining room at one of the best WA coast cabins

Enjoy this modern craftsman cabin surrounded by seagrass and sand dunes. Go to the beach, make the 10-minute walk to town, or relax around the fire pit. Inside you’ll find multiple TVs, an Xbox, and modern decor inviting you to stay a while.
